Environment Grow your green haven with our free tree giveaway [https://news.cityofsydney.nsw.gov.au/announcements/grow-your-green-haven-with-our-free-tree-giveaway]

We’re giving away 1,000 free trees to City of Sydney residents. Each household can take to up to 2 free trees until we run out.

Pick from small, medium and large native and exotic trees.

Come along to Sydney Park on Saturday 5 April from 9am to 1pm or until we run out.

Insects fight food waste naturally [https://news.cityofsydney.nsw.gov.au/articles/nsw-first-residential-trial-insects-transform-food-waste]

For the first time in NSW, black soldier fly larvae or maggots are turning your food scraps into animal feed and fertiliser.

Mapping microclimates: find out where it's hottest and coolest in our area [https://www.cityofsydney.nsw.gov.au/research-reports/mapping-summer-microclimates]

We partnered with Western Sydney University to document air temperatures and relative humidity across our area.

We found air temperatures differ significantly across the city. During hot (35°C+) and extreme heat (40°C+) days, temperature differences from north to south can exceed 10°C.
